B16B 08-15-2005 07:49 PM

if you gut the out of your car and run a drag radial or slick for the track and it runs a 13.0... but then you put your car all back together, adding back in all the extra weight, putting on the street tires, the car is going to run slower... so for this example lets say the car runs a 13.6 when its is in street trim. So you go boasting you run a 13.0 (at the track) and get walked by a guy who runs a consistant 13.4 full interior... realistic representation
